Professional Nursing Organization and Certification

The American association of nurse practitioners (AANP) is an organization that was established in 1985 by a small group of nurses who saw the vision of the nurse expansion in Pennsylvania (AANP, 2015). The organization was formed to address the various issues that were arising in the practice and therefore was formed as a unified body to voice the concerns of the nurse practitioners. The mission of the association entails being a professional membership organization for nurse practitioners in every nursing field that is responsible for transforming the patient centered health care (). The vision statement of AANP aspires for the provision of high quality care for all by those who have been mandated to do so (i.e. health care providers). The association also has core values that include integrity whereby, they promise to be reliable, ethical, and respectful and transparency. At the same time, they have other core values that include excellence performance where the client’s needs are put at core and functions to exceed expectations. Professionalism in all their undertaking, leadership in practice and enduring commitment to the members are other values of the association.
